Cache, Equipment, & Uniform Assistant

Conservation Begins Here.
The Student Conservation Association (SCA), America’s #1 conservation service organization seeks qualified applicants to support programs.  This position is located in Charlestown, NH.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Maintain equipment  to meet SCA, outdoor industry, and OSHA standards; participate in the development of safety and use standards
  • Prepare, distribute, ship, receive, repair, and inventory equipment, first aid, and uniform supplies as needed for all SCA programs and functions
  • Maintain positive and beneficial relationships with current equipment vendors and establish new vendor accounts to effectively and economically ensure that programs are provided with quality equipment
  • Manage and improve the Equipment Asset Tracking System/Inventory
  • Purchase, maintain, repair, and supply trail tools in a manner consistent with SCA standards and ensure that the tool storage/ workspace meets all SCA and OSHA standards
  • Assist SCA programs with the purchasing and loaning of gear as needed
  • Help facilitate Leader Trainings
  • Meet all requirements of a designated field staff member, visit crews as a rover or serve as Crew Leader, when needed, and serve as Program Responder

Qualifications:

  • Must be a minimum of 21 years of age
  • Must have ability to legally work in the US
  • Ability to perform manual, physical labor for up to 8 hours per day, exposed to the elements and must occasionally lift and/or move 40 pounds or more
  • 2-3 years experience working in a supply and logistics work environment and knowledge of outdoor equipment and tools
  • Team leadership and supervisory experience
  • Knowledge of programming, outdoor field experience,  and youth leadership
  • Strong oral and written communication skills
  • Proven organizational skills
  • Intermediate data MS Office knowledge
  • Experience working with inventory or asset tracking systems
  • Certified as Wilderness First Responder with CPR
  • Willingness to travel
  • Valid driver’s license and MVR that meets SCA standards required
  • Ability to meet SCA’s criminal background check standards

Compensation: full time, season (9 months), $12/hour
